淄博阿里云代理商:app调用mysql数据库

如果您需要在您的APP中使用MySQL数据库,您需要遵循以下步骤:

  1. 创建一个MySQL数据库实例:在阿里云控制台中创建一个MySQL数据库实例,并获取该实例的连接信息。
  2. 编写代码:在您的APP中使用MySQL连接接口,例如JDBC。您需要编写代码以连接到MySQL数据库,执行SQL查询并处理结果。
  3. 配置数据库连接:将您的MySQL连接配置信息添加到您的APP的配置文件中,以便在您的代码中使用。
  4. 测试应用程序:使用模拟数据测试您的APP,确保所有功能都可以正常工作。

注意事项:

  1. 对于MySQL数据库的安全和性能问题,采用以下最佳实践:
  • 按需授予用户访问权限。只为需要访问数据库的用户授予权限,避免使用具有ROOT权限的账号连接数据库。
  • 对于敏感信息,使用加密技术保护。
  • 使用连接池优化性能,避免每次连接都需要建立新的网络连接。
  1. 在编写代码之前,建议先阅读MySQL的官方文档,了解如何使用MySQL的各种功能以及在处理大量数据时如何优化性能。

要在APP中调用MySQL数据库,您需要使用以下步骤:

  1. 下载并安装MySQL Connector/C++驱动程序,该程序包允许通过C++代码连接MySQL数据库。
  2. 在您的APP中,引入MySQL Connector/C++的头文件。
  3. 使用以下代码来建立与MySQL数据库的连接:

    #include <mysql_connection.h>
    #include <mysql_driver.h>
    #include <cppconn/exception.h>
    #include <cppconn/resultset.h>
    #include <cppconn/statement.h>
      
    //建立连接
    sql::mysql::MySQL_Driver* driver;
    sql::Connection* con;
    sql::Statement* stmt;
    sql::ResultSet* res;
    driver = sql::mysql::get_driver_instance();
    con = driver->connect("tcp://127.0.0.1:3306", "root", "password"); //连接MySQL服务器
    con->setSchema("your_database"); //选择在APP中使用的数据库
    
  4. 在连接成功后,您可以使用Statement对象来执行SQL查询语句,例如:

    stmt = con->createStatement();
    res = stmt->executeQuery("SELECT * FROM your_table");
    while (res->next()) {
      std::cout <<"id:"<< res->getInt("id") << ", name:" << res->getString("name") << ", age:" << res->getInt("age") << std::endl;
    }

    这将查询您所选的数据库中的表,并返回结果集。您可以根据需要处理结果集。

    淄博阿里云代理商:app调用mysql数据库
  5. 最后,要关闭连接,请使用以下代码:

    delete res;
    delete stmt;
    delete con;

这就是在APP中调用MySQL数据库的基本步骤。请记得在使用MySQL数据库时要适当考虑数据安全性,例如使用绑定参数等技术来避免SQL注入攻击。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/157663.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年3月7日 00:15
下一篇 2024年3月7日 00:37

相关推荐

  • 昆明阿里云代理商:amp产品认证

    阿里云的AMP(云原生应用管理平台)产品是一款为云原生应用提供全生命周期管理的解决方案。它提供持续集成、持续交付、自动化部署和监控等功能,帮助用户加速应用开发、提高部署效率以及保障应用的稳定性。 要成为昆明的阿里云代理商并获得AMP产品的认证,您需要以下步骤: 注册阿里云合作伙伴账号: 在阿里云合作伙伴官方网站进行注册,填写相关信息。 申请成为阿里云代理商:…

    2024年1月4日
    43200
  • 阿里云网关方案开发

    阿里云服务器子网掩码和网关怎么设置 云服务器不需要设置的,系统自动给你分配如果你改了网关的话,就连不上服务器了 阿里云备案网站建设方案书可以不要么? 可以不要。网站建设方案书要求:单位性质备案域名不同前缀 超过 31 个 (不含 31 个)时,需提供每个域名的网站建设方案书,及加盖备案专用章的阿里云保证书。个人性质备案前缀不同 超过 5 个(不含 5 个) …

    2023年8月29日
    47200
  • 阿里云企业邮箱:如何设置邮件内容敏感度分级?

    阿里云企业邮箱:如何设置邮件内容敏感度分级 在现代企业中,电子邮件是重要的沟通工具。然而,随着信息安全问题的日益突出,企业需要对邮件内容进行敏感度分级,以保护敏感信息。阿里云企业邮箱作为一款专业的企业邮箱服务,提供了强大的功能来帮助企业实现这一目标。本文将详细介绍如何在阿里云企业邮箱中设置邮件内容敏感度分级,并结合阿里云企业邮箱及其代理商的优势进行说明。 阿…

    2025年4月10日
    27900
  • 汉中阿里云企业邮箱代理商:阿里云个人邮箱官网入口

    汉中阿里云企业邮箱代理商:阿里云个人邮箱官网入口 阿里云企业邮箱是一款专为企业用户打造的高效、安全、稳定的企业邮箱服务。作为汉中地区的阿里云企业邮箱代理商,我们将为您提供优质的服务和技术支持,让您的企业邮箱运营更加顺畅。 阿里云企业邮箱的优势: 1. 企业级服务 阿里云企业邮箱提供专业的企业级邮箱服务,支持企业定制化需求,满足不同规模企业的邮件通信需求。 2…

    2024年2月19日
    41600
  • 岳阳阿里云代理商:安全增强服务

    岳阳阿里云代理商通过提供安全增强服务,帮助客户确保在阿里云平台上的数据和应用安全。这些服务包括以下几个方面: 防火墙:岳阳阿里云代理商可以协助客户设置和配置防火墙,通过限制网络流量,防止未经授权的访问和攻击。 安全监控:岳阳阿里云代理商可以为客户提供实时安全监控服务,监测潜在的安全风险和威胁,并及时采取措施进行应对。 数据加密:岳阳阿里云代理商可以协助客户设…

    2024年1月9日
    45100

发表回复

登录后才能评论

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/